A garph y=2 represents a line parallel to the x axis with the y coordinate equal to 2.
The point which lies on the y=2 graph has its y coordinate equal to 2.
In the given options, (3,2) is the coordinate with the y coordinate equal to 2.
Hence, (3,2) lies on the graph of y = 2.
Option (D) is the answer.
